  • Applikationshinweise

    Western blot, 0.25-0.5 μg/mL, Human, Mouse, Rat, Monkey
    Immunohistochemistry(Paraffin-embedded Section), 2-5 μg/mL, Human, Mouse, Rat
    Immunocytochemistry/Immunofluorescence, 5 μg/mL, Human
    Flow Cytometry (Fixed), 1-3 μg/1x106 cells, Human
    ELISA, 0.1-0.5 μg/mL, -

    Informationen zur Lagerung

    At -20°C for one year from date of receipt. After reconstitution, at 4°C for one month.
    It can also be aliquotted and stored frozen at -20°C for six months. Avoid repeated freezing and thawing.

    Background: Kinectin is a protein that in humans is encoded by the KTN1 gene. This gene encodes an integral membrane protein that is a member of the kinectin protein family. The encoded protein is primarily localized to the endoplasmic reticulum membrane. This protein binds kinesin and may be involved in intracellular organelle motility. This protein also binds translation elongation factor-delta and may be involved in the assembly of the elongation factor-1 complex. Alternate splicing results in multiple transcript variants of this gene.
